Health & Safety Initiatives

Macarthur Coal continues to work closely with all minesite and corporate office personnel to cultivate a culture of safety improvement and vigilance in the control of hazards. The target is zero injuries and fatalities.

 

The following initiatives help us to achieve this target:

  

New HSEC Plan

Following independent audits of Coppabella and Moorvale Mines in early 2005, Macarthur Coal worked with contractors to design and implement a new Health, Safety Environment and Community (HSEC) plan which provides standard and consistent procedures for all Macarthur Coal and contract staff working in both mines. On commencement, all new contract and Macarthur Coal staff will receive training in the new procedures and current staff have been retrained to ensure all are aware of the new requirements. The new HSEC has currently been implemented at Moorvale Mine and it is expected to be rolled out at Coppabella Mine by the end of 2007. A company-wide crisis management plan which puts in place the procedures and protocols to be followed should a crisis occur either onsite or in the corporate office forms part of the HSEC.

 

Fatigue Management

A major Fatigue Management Survey of all staff and contractors at both minesites was completed. The purpose of the survey was to determine practical ways to decrease the risks associated with fatigue, particularly with respect to travel to and from work. Macarthur Coal is examining several strategies to deal with issues highlighted in the survey such as flexible working hours, car pooling, better housing close to site and alternative travel options.

 

Healthy Employees

Macarthur Coal supports its employees in achieving and maintaining fit and healthy lifestyles. The Company sponsors a free mobile gym for use by minesite personnel, their families and the community. Students from Nebo State School attend the gym weekly.

 

Corporate office employees receive financial reimbursement of up to $1,500 per employee per annum for gym memberships or use of personal trainers. In addition, Macarthur Coal sponsors a weekly exercise session provided by a personal trainer which is held in the corporate office for any employees wishing to attend.
